Latest Patents
Klug's patent titled "Device for repositioning a rotating element" provides a novel approach to maintaining a defined normal position for rotary members. The device features a spatially stationary fixed catch that determines the normal position and a driver catch that is coupled to the rotary member. This design includes stop surfaces on opposing sides of each catch, along with a clamping spring that ensures there is no rotary play between the clamping spring and the catches when in the normal position. An elastic spring element further enhances the functionality, making the device an essential component in applications requiring precise rotary alignment.
